Fasteners typically include the following 13 types of parts
1. Bolt: A type of fastener consisting of a head and a screw (cylindrical body with external threads), which needs to be matched with a nut to fasten and connect two parts with through holes. This type of connection is called bolted connection. If the nut is unscrewed from the bolt, it can separate these two parts, so the bolt connection is a detachable connection.
2. Stud: A type of fastener that does not have a head and only has external threads on both ends. When connecting, one end needs to be screwed into the part with an internal threaded hole, and the other end needs to pass through the part with a through-hole, and then screw on the nut, even if these two parts are tightly connected as a whole. This type of connection is called a bolted connection and is also a detachable connection. Mainly used in situations where one of the connected parts has a large thickness, requires a compact structure, or is not suitable for bolt connection due to frequent disassembly.
3. Screw: It is also a type of fastener consisting of a head and a screw, which can be divided into three categories according to their use: machine screws, set screws, and special-purpose screws. Machine screws are mainly used for fastening connections between a part with a threaded hole and a part with a through-hole, without the need for nut fitting (this type of connection is called a screw connection, which is also a detachable connection; it can also be used in conjunction with a nut for fastening connections between two parts with through-hole). Tightening screws are mainly used to fix the relative position between two parts. Special purpose screws such as lifting ring screws are used for lifting parts.
4. Nut: with internal threaded holes, generally in the shape of a flat hexagonal column, but also in the shape of a flat square column or a flat cylindrical shape, used in conjunction with bolts, screws or machine screws to fasten and connect two parts into a whole.
5. Self tapping screw: Similar to machine screws, but the thread on the screw is a specialized thread for self tapping screws. Used to fasten and connect two thin metal components into a single unit, small holes need to be pre made on the components. Due to the high hardness of these screws, they can be directly screwed into the holes of the components to form responsive internal threads
6. Wood screws: Similar to machine screws, but the thread on the screw is a specialized wood screw thread that can be directly screwed into a wooden component (or part) to securely connect a metal (or non-metal) part with a through-hole to a wooden component. This type of connection is also a detachable connection.
7. Gasket: A type of fastener with a flat circular shape. Placed between the support surface of bolts, screws or nuts and the surface of the connecting parts, it plays a role in increasing the contact surface area of the connected parts, reducing the unit area pressure, and protecting the surface of the connected parts from damage; Another type of elastic washer can also prevent the nut from loosening.
8. Retaining ring: Used to be installed in the shaft groove or hole groove of machines or equipment, it plays a role in preventing the parts on the shaft or hole from moving left and right.
9. Sales: Mainly used for component positioning, some can also be used for component connection, fixing components, transmitting power, or locking other fasteners.
10. Rivet: A type of fastener consisting of a head and a shank, used to fasten and connect two parts (or components) with through holes, making them a whole. This type of connection is called rivet connection, abbreviated as riveting. Belonging to non detachable connections. Because to separate the two connected parts, it is necessary to break the rivets on the parts.
11. Combination parts and connecting pairs: Combination parts refer to a type of fastener supplied in combination, such as a machine screw (or bolt, self supplied screw) supplied in combination with a flat washer (or spring washer, locking washer); Connecting accessories refer to a type of fastener that combines a specific type of bolt, nut, and washer for supply
12. Welding nail: A heterogeneous fastener composed of light energy and nail head (or no nail head), which is fixed and connected to a part (or component) by welding method for further connection with other parts.
13. Steel wire thread sleeve: Steel wire thread sleeve is a new type of threaded connection component, which is refined from high-strength, high-precision corrosion-resistant diamond wire. Shaped like a spring, installed in a specific screw hole on the base, its inner surface forms standard threads. When matched with screws (bolts), it can significantly improve the strength and wear resistance of the threaded connection; Especially on low strength materials such as aluminum, magnesium, cast iron, and plastic.
